1. Thinking only about style without considering use
A trendy mini bag is lovely… but can it really hold everything you need?
Tip: Think about your daily life: travel, essential items, frequency of use.
2. Choosing a bag that is too heavy or poorly designed
Some bags are beautiful... but they're already heavy when empty! Or their handles keep slipping, or the zippers don't hold.
Tip: Prioritize comfort of use. A beautiful bag shouldn't be a constraint.
3. Neglecting material and quality
A bag that is not very durable can quickly become damaged, especially if it is used daily.
Tip: Check the quality of the seams, handles, and material. Leather, imitation leather, or canvas: each choice has its advantages (see our materials guide ).
4. Not taking into account your body shape
A bag that's too big can make a petite figure look too big, while one that's too small on a tall person can look lost.
Tip: match the size of your bag to your body shape (see our article on bags and body shapes) .
5. Succumbing to a trend that is too strong
Ultra-trendy bags are tempting… but you might not like them in a few months.
Tip: Invest in timeless pieces that you'll still enjoy wearing next year.
